Star Wars: The Complete Blu-ray Saga will feature all six live-action Star Wars feature films utilizing the highest possible picture and audio presentation.

Star Wars Episode I: The Phantom Menace
(32 Years Before Episode IV) Stranded on the desert planet Tatooine after rescuing young Queen Amidala from the impending invasion of Naboo, Jedi apprentice Obi-Wan Kenobi and his Jedi Master discover nine-year-old Anakin Skywalker, a young slave unusually strong in the Force. Anakin wins a thrilling Podrace and with it his freedom as he leaves his home to be trained as a Jedi. The heroes return to Naboo where Anakin and the Queen face massive invasion forces while the two Jedi contend with a deadly foe named Darth Maul. Only then do they realize the invasion is merely the first step in a sinister scheme by the re-emergent forces of darkness known as the Sith.

Star Wars Episode II: Attack of the Clones
(22 Years Before Episode IV) Ten years after the events of the Battle of Naboo, not only has the galaxy undergone significant change, but so have Obi-Wan Kenobi, Padmé Amidala, and Anakin Skywalker as they are thrown together again for the first time since the Trade Federation invasion of Naboo. Anakin has grown into the accomplished Jedi apprentice of Obi-Wan, who himself has transitioned from student to teacher. The two Jedi are assigned to protect Padmé whose life is threatened by a faction of political separatists. As relationships form and powerful forces collide, these heroes face choices that will impact not only their own fates, but the destiny of the Republic.

Star Wars Episode III: Revenge of the Sith
(19 Years before Episode IV) Three years after the onset of the Clone Wars, the noble Jedi Knights have been leading a massive clone army into a galaxy-wide battle against the Separatists. When the sinister Sith unveil a thousand-year-old plot to rule the galaxy, the Republic crumbles and from its ashes rises the evil Galactic Empire. Jedi hero Anakin Skywalker is seduced by the dark side of the Force to become the Emperor's new apprentice--Darth Vader. The Jedi are decimated, as Obi-Wan Kenobi and Jedi Master Yoda are forced into hiding. The only hope for the galaxy are Anakin's own offspring.

Star Wars Episode IV: A New Hope
Nineteen years after the formation of the Empire, Luke Skywalker is thrust into the struggle of the Rebel Alliance when he meets Obi-Wan Kenobi, who has lived for years in seclusion on the desert planet of Tatooine. Obi-Wan begins Luke's Jedi training as Luke joins him on a daring mission to rescue the beautiful Rebel leader Princess Leia from the clutches of the evil Empire.

Star Wars Episode V: The Empire Strikes Back
Luke Skywalker and his friends have set up a new base on the ice planet of Hoth, but it is not long before their secret location is discovered by the evil Empire. After narrowly escaping, Luke splits off from his friends to seek out a Jedi Master called Yoda. Meanwhile, Han Solo, Chewbacca, Princess Leia, and C-3PO seek sanctuary at a city in the Clouds run by Lando Calrissian, an old friend of Han’s. But little do they realize that Darth Vader already awaits them.

Star Wars Episode VI: Return of the Jedi
(4 years after Episode IV) In the epic conclusion of the saga, the Empire prepares to crush the Rebellion with a more powerful Death Star while the Rebel fleet mounts a massive attack on the space station. Luke Skywalker confronts Darth Vader in a final climactic duel before the evil Emperor.

Features To Expect From The Best Crib Mattress

!±8± Features To Expect From The Best Crib Mattress

Mattresses are bought to offer comfort in bed especially during the night when people are sleeping. Crib mattresses are specifically designed for little children and therefore their surfaces are very different from those of standard beds. They are smaller in size, both width and height and are placed or fitted in cribs which are small beds for infant children. They consist of high sides that prevent the baby from falling down. When doing your shopping there are certain features that you ought to consider so that you are able to purchase the best crib mattress.

Features To Look Out For
The following features are very important and should be considered when you are doing your shopping:

• Size: This is probably the most important consideration you need to make before finalizing the purchase. The surfaces vary and that means the sizes of the item also varies. You need to have prior knowledge of the size where you are going to fit the item so that once you purchase, you will not have to return it to the seller because it does not fit, either too large or too small.

• Firmness: Another very important feature that you need to look out for is the firmness of the material. Since your babies spend most of their time sleeping, you need to ensure that the material used is firm and will not bulge under the baby's weight. Lack of firmness of mattresses has been known to be a major cause of backbone problems. The surface needs to be firmly straight horizontally.

• Cost: There are two sides to this feature that you should look at. First, a very costly purchase could have, negative implications to your budget. Secondly, cheapness is always associated with poor quality. Therefore make sure you make a purchase that is affordable to you but at the same time, that which will offer you good and durable service.

• Weight: Many people associate weight with quality. That, the more weight an item carries the better quality it is. Well, this is not necessarily the case. The best crib mattress should not be too heavy; rather a light one is ideal for portability, since you may need to constantly move houses.

• Manufacturer: Just like any other item it is very important to consider the manufacturer. Some manufacturers and brands are known to produce quality mattresses. Go for the manufacturers who have been in the market for some time since they are the only one who are well versed with the needs of their clients.

• Terms and Conditions: Consider the terms and conditions the seller is giving you. For example, their return policy and the duration of the warranty that you are offered.

• Reputation: It is important to find out what other people are saying about the different brands available. You can do this by looking at product reviews.
